What Is Parchment Paper and Why Bakers Trust It

Parchment paper is a specially treated paper designed to resist heat and moisture. It creates a barrier between food and baking surfaces, preventing sticking while allowing even heat distribution. This feature is essential for producing consistent baking results.

The paper is coated with silicone, which gives it natural non-stick properties. Because of this coating, foods such as cookies or pastries slide off easily after baking. Professional bakers rely on silicone-coated baking paper to protect delicate textures and shapes.

Another important benefit is durability. High-quality heat-resistant baking paper can withstand temperatures commonly used in ovens. This reliability ensures that bakers can use it across multiple recipes without worrying about burning or tearing.

How Parchment Paper Improves Baking Results

Consistency is one of the most important goals in professional baking. When trays are lined with oven-safe parchment sheets, heat circulates more evenly around the food. This leads to uniform browning and better texture.

Another advantage is moisture control. Some baked goods release oils or sugar during baking. Heat-resistant baking paper absorbs a small amount of grease while still maintaining a protective barrier, helping pastries bake properly without sticking.

Delicate items such as macarons, meringues, and cookies benefit the most. Without proper lining, these foods may break apart when removed from trays. Using silicone-coated baking paper helps preserve their shape and appearance.

Common Baking Applications for Parchment Paper

Professional bakers use parchment paper in many different situations. Its versatility makes it useful in both baking and cooking environments.

Baking Cookies and Pastries

Cookies and pastries often contain sugar and butter that can stick easily to baking trays. Lining trays with non-stick baking paper prevents this problem and keeps baked goods intact.

It also reduces the need for greasing pans. This helps maintain the intended texture of pastries without adding unnecessary oils. Many bakeries rely on pre-cut parchment sheets for quick preparation.

Cake and Bread Preparation

Cake pans are often lined with parchment circles before batter is poured. This technique ensures that cakes release smoothly after baking. Professional pastry chefs frequently depend on heat-resistant baking paper to maintain presentation quality.

Bread baking also benefits from parchment. Dough can be transferred directly into ovens without sticking to trays. This method keeps the structure intact during baking.

Roasting and Savory Cooking

Although commonly associated with desserts, parchment paper is also useful for roasting vegetables and proteins. It prevents food from sticking while allowing even heat exposure.

Restaurants often line trays with oven-safe parchment sheets when roasting ingredients in large batches. This method improves kitchen efficiency and simplifies cleanup.

Parchment Paper vs Other Baking Liners

Different materials can be used to line baking trays. However, each option performs differently depending on the recipe and cooking temperature.

Baking Liner

Heat Resistance

Non-Stick Performance

Cleanup

Parchment Paper

High

Excellent

Very easy

Aluminum Foil

Moderate

Low without oil

Moderate

Wax Paper

Low

Moderate

Easy but not oven safe

Professional bakers prefer silicone-coated baking paper because it combines heat resistance with reliable non-stick performance. Unlike wax paper, it is safe for oven use.

Foil can sometimes cause uneven browning. By contrast, oven-safe parchment sheets support balanced heat distribution across the tray.

Tips for Using Parchment Paper Like a Professional Baker

Experienced bakers follow certain practices when working with parchment paper. These methods help maintain efficiency and consistent baking results.

  • Choose high-quality heat-resistant baking paper for ovens
  • Use pre-cut parchment sheets for faster tray preparation
  • Trim paper to match pan size for better heat circulation
  • Avoid exposing parchment directly to open flames
  • Store sheets in a dry area to maintain quality

These simple techniques allow bakeries to maximize the benefits of non-stick baking paper while maintaining smooth kitchen operations.

Choosing the Right Parchment Paper for Your Kitchen

Not all parchment products are identical. Professional bakers often select specific types depending on their needs.

Pre-Cut Sheets

Pre-cut options save time in high-volume kitchens. Bakers can line trays instantly without measuring or cutting paper.

These sheets are commonly used in commercial bakeries because they streamline workflow. Many kitchens rely on pre-cut parchment sheets during busy production hours.

Rolls for Flexible Use

Rolls provide flexibility for different pan sizes and cooking methods. They allow bakers to customize the length needed for each recipe.

Restaurants frequently choose heat-resistant baking paper rolls for roasting or wrapping foods during cooking.

Unbleached Baking Paper

Some kitchens prefer unbleached varieties made without chlorine treatment. These products maintain the same non-stick qualities while supporting environmentally conscious practices.

Many professional chefs use silicone-coated baking paper regardless of whether it is bleached or natural.
